Material React Table logo Material React Table

Material React Table, a fully featured Material UI V5 implementation of TanStack React Table V8. Written from the ground up in TypeScript.

assertpy logo assertpy

A straightforward assertion library for Python.

Material React Table features and specs

  • Easy Integration
    Material React Table can be easily integrated with React applications, especially those already using Material-UI, providing a consistent design and seamless component usage.
  • Customizable Styling
    Offers a high degree of customization through Material-UI's theming and styling capabilities, allowing developers to tailor the table's appearance to match their application's look and feel.
  • Rich Feature Set
    Includes a variety of built-in features like pagination, sorting, filtering, and selection, reducing the need for additional libraries and custom development.
  • Component Modularity
    The table is composed of modular components, allowing developers to use specific parts of the table as needed and providing flexibility in implementation.
  • Responsive Design
    Designed to be responsive out of the box, which ensures it works well on different screen sizes and devices without additional configuration.

Possible disadvantages of Material React Table

  • Learning Curve
    Although powerful, the library may require a learning curve for those unfamiliar with Material-UI or its paradigms, potentially increasing development time for new users.
  • Performance Overhead
    For applications that do not require all of its features, Material React Table may introduce unnecessary overhead, potentially affecting performance.
  • Dependency on Material-UI
    It relies on Material-UI, which may add a dependency that some developers prefer to avoid if they are using a different design framework or no framework at all.
  • Limited Advanced Customization
    While it offers customization, truly advanced use cases or uncommon layout requirements might still necessitate additional custom development beyond what is easily configurable.
  • Version Compatibility
    Compatibility with different versions of React and Material-UI might sometimes be a challenge, requiring caution during updates and upgrades to ensure everything works harmoniously.

assertpy features and specs

  • Fluent API
    Assertpy offers a fluent API that makes assertions more readable and expressive, enabling developers to write assertions in a natural language style that is easy to understand.
  • Chainable Assertions
    It allows for chainable assertions, enabling multiple checks to be performed in a single line of code, thereby reducing verbosity and enhancing clarity.
  • Comprehensive Assertion Methods
    The library provides a wide range of built-in assertion methods, catering to various types of data validations, such as checking for size, type, value, and more.
  • Extensibility
    Assertpy supports extending its functionality by defining custom assertions, allowing developers to tailor it to their specific needs.
  • Pythonic
    Designed with Pythonic principles in mind, Assertpy fits seamlessly into Python projects, enabling idiomatic and consistent code style.

Possible disadvantages of assertpy

  • Learning Curve
    Developers new to the library may encounter a learning curve due to the distinct approach of using fluent and chainable assertions as opposed to traditional methods.
  • Limited by Python Version
    The library may have limitations in terms of compatibility with older versions of Python, requiring users to ensure their environment is up-to-date.
  • Performance Overhead
    The additional abstraction layer introduced by a fluent interface might introduce some performance overhead, especially in performance-critical or resource-constrained environments.
  • Less Community Support
    Compared to more established testing libraries, Assertpy might have less community support and fewer resources available for resolving issues or getting help.
  • Dependency Management
    Using a third-party library introduces additional dependencies to manage, which could complicate project maintenance and compatibility.

The Best React Data Grid/Table Libraries with Material Design in 2023 - MRT Blog
The final library on this list is Material React Table. This is a relatively new library that was first released in September 2022. Unlike the two previously mentioned libraries, Material React Table is 100% free to use with the MIT license. It is also built directly on top of Material UI v5 and exclusively uses Material UI components under the hood, so it will fit right in...
